tests/testthat/test-check_character.R

# Test check_is_character ----

test_that(
  "check is character works - TRUE",
  {
    expect_true(
      object = check_is_character(x = "I_Shall_Pass",
                                  error = FALSE)
    )

    expect_true(
      object = check_is_character(x = "I_Shall_Pass",
                                  error = TRUE)
    )

    expect_true(
      object = check_is_character(x = c("I_Shall_Pass"),
                                  error = FALSE)
    )

    expect_true(
      object = check_is_character(x = c("I_Shall_Pass"),
                                  error = TRUE)
    )

    expect_true(
      object = check_is_character(x = c("I_Shall_Pass",
                                        NULL),
                                  error = FALSE)
    )

    expect_true(
      object = check_is_character(x = c("I_Shall_Pass",
                                        NULL),
                                  error = TRUE)
    )

    expect_true(
      object = check_is_character(x = c("I_Shall_Pass",
                                        "I_Shall_Not_Pass"),
                                  error = TRUE)
    )

    expect_true(
      object = check_is_character(x = c("I_Shall_Pass",
                                        "I_Shall_Not_Pass"),
                                  error = FALSE)
    )
  }
)

test_that(
  "check is character works - FALSE",
  {
    expect_false(
      object = check_is_character(x = c("I_Shall_Pass",
                                        NA_character_),
                                  error = FALSE)
    )

    expect_false(
      object = check_is_character(x = NA_character_,
                                  error = FALSE)
    )

    expect_false(
      object = check_is_character(x = NULL,
                                  error = FALSE)
    )

    expect_false(
      object = check_is_character(x = 1,
                                  error = FALSE)
    )

    expect_false(
      object = check_is_character(x = 1L,
                                  error = FALSE)
    )

    expect_false(
      object = check_is_character(x = TRUE,
                                  error = FALSE)
    )
  }
)

test_that(
  "check is character works - ERROR",
  {
    expect_error(
      object = check_is_character(x = c("I_Shall_Pass",
                                        NA_character_),
                                  error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a character vector!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_character(x = NA_character_,
                                  error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a character vector!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_character(x = NULL,
                                  error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a character vector!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_character(x = 1,
                                  error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a character vector!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_character(x = 1L,
                                  error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a character vector!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_character(x = TRUE,
                                  error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a character vector!",
                    fixed = TRUE)
    )
  }
)

# Test check_is_scalar_character ----

test_that(
  "check is scalar character works - TRUE",
  {
    expect_true(
      object = check_is_scalar_character(x = "I_Shall_Pass",
                                         error = TRUE)
    )

    expect_true(
      object = check_is_scalar_character(x = "I_Shall_Pass",
                                         error = FALSE)
    )

    expect_true(
      object = check_is_scalar_character(x = c("I_Shall_Pass"),
                                         error = TRUE)
    )

    expect_true(
      object = check_is_scalar_character(x = c("I_Shall_Pass"),
                                         error = FALSE)
    )

    expect_true(
      object = check_is_scalar_character(x = c("I_Shall_Pass",
                                               NULL),
                                         error = TRUE)
    )

    expect_true(
      object = check_is_scalar_character(x = c("I_Shall_Pass",
                                               NULL),
                                         error = FALSE)
    )
  }
)

test_that(
  "check is scalar character works - FALSE",
  {
    expect_false(
      object = check_is_scalar_character(x = c("I_Shall_Pass",
                                               "I_Shall_Not_Pass"),
                                         error = FALSE)
    )

    expect_false(
      object = check_is_scalar_character(x = c("I_Shall_Pass",
                                               NA_character_),
                                         error = FALSE)
    )

    expect_false(
      object = check_is_scalar_character(x = NA_character_,
                                         error = FALSE)
    )

    expect_false(
      object = check_is_scalar_character(x = NULL,
                                         error = FALSE)
    )

    expect_false(
      object = check_is_scalar_character(x = 1,
                                         error = FALSE)
    )

    expect_false(
      object = check_is_scalar_character(x = 1L,
                                         error = FALSE)
    )

    expect_false(
      object = check_is_scalar_character(x = TRUE,
                                         error = FALSE)
    )
  }
)

test_that(
  "check is scalar character works - ERROR",
  {
    expect_error(
      object = check_is_scalar_character(x = c("I_Shall_Pass",
                                               "I_Shall_Not_Pass"),
                                         error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a scalar character!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_scalar_character(x = c("I_Shall_Pass",
                                               NA_character_),
                                         error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a scalar character!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_scalar_character(x = NA_character_,
                                         error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a scalar character!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_scalar_character(x = NULL,
                                         error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a scalar character!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_scalar_character(x = 1,
                                         error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a scalar character!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_scalar_character(x = 1L,
                                         error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a scalar character!",
                    fixed = TRUE)
    )

    expect_error(
      object = check_is_scalar_character(x = TRUE,
                                         error = TRUE),
      regexp = gsub(pattern = " ",
                    replacement = "([[:space:]].*|\\n.*)?",
                    x = "must be a scalar character!",
                    fixed = TRUE)
    )
  }
)
